The Tampa Bay Lightning (32-13-4) visit the Columbus Blue Jackets (23-20-7) at Nationwide Arena on Saturday, Jan. 24 at 7 p.m. ET on ESPN+. The Lightning have won three straight games.

Lightning Splits and Trends
- The Lightning are 7-4-11 in overtime contests as part of a 32-13-4 overall record.
- Tampa Bay is 7-7-2 (16 points) in its 16 games decided by one goal.
- Looking at the five times this season the Lightning ended a game with just one goal, they have a 2-2-1 record, good for five points.
- Tampa Bay has scored exactly two goals in 11 games this season (3-5-3 record, nine points).
- The Lightning have scored at least three goals in 31 games (27-4-0, 54 points).
- In the 15 games when Tampa Bay has scored a single power-play goal, it has a 10-3-2 record (22 points).
- In the 26 games when it outshot its opponent, Tampa Bay is 14-9-3 (31 points).
- The Lightning have been outshot by opponents in 22 games, going 17-4-1 to record 35 points.
Blue Jackets Splits and Trends
- The Blue Jackets have earned a record of 9-7-16 in overtime matchups as part of an overall mark of 23-20-7.
- In the 21 games Columbus has played that were decided by one goal, it racked up 22 points.
- In 11 games this season when the Blue Jackets ended a game with just one goal, they earned a total of six points (2-7-2).
- Columbus failed to win all seven games this season when it scored exactly two goals.
- The Blue Jackets have scored three or more goals 30 times, earning 47 points from those matchups (21-4-5).
- Columbus has scored a single power-play goal in 13 games this season and has registered 17 points from those matchups.
- When outshooting its opponent this season, Columbus is 13-10-3 (29 points).
- The Blue Jackets have been outshot by opponents 23 times this season, and earned 24 points in those games.
